T.J. MacGregor’s standalone novels cover a wide stretch of her career, from In Shadow (1985) to White Crows (2022). The earlier books tend toward straightforward mystery and thriller territory, while the later entries lean more heavily into paranormal and speculative fiction.
The Seventh Sense (1999) and Vanished (2001) sit at the transition point, mixing suspense with elements that go beyond standard crime fiction. Out of Sight (2002) continues that approach. The more recent standalones, including U R miNe (2016), Skin Shifters (2018), and White Crows (2022), move further into supernatural territory. Across the decades, the books share MacGregor’s fast pacing and her interest in characters who encounter things they cannot easily explain.
